Hemp is one of the most useful plants known to humanity. A variety of Cannabis sativa, it is cultivated specifically for industrial, nutritional, and Hemp material purposes. Unlike other cannabis plants, hemp contains only trace amounts of THC, so it produces no psychoactive effects. This distinction allows hemp to be grown legally in many places for practical applications rather than recreational use.
What makes hemp truly special is its remarkable efficiency and sustainability. The plant grows quickly, often reaching full height in just 100 to 120 days. It thrives with relatively little water and usually needs no chemical pesticides or herbicides when managed properly. Hemp naturally suppresses weeds due to its dense canopy and improves soil structure by aerating the ground with its deep roots. After harvest, the remaining roots help prevent erosion and add organic matter back to the earth.
The strongest part of the plant is its long bast fiber, found in the outer layer of the stem. These fibers are exceptionally durable, resistant to rot, and stronger than many synthetic alternatives. For centuries, hemp fiber was used to make sturdy ropes for ships, heavy-duty canvas for sails and tents, and tough clothing for laborers. Modern hemp textiles are soft, breathable, and long-lasting. They wick moisture away from the skin, resist bacteria naturally, and become more comfortable with repeated washing. Hemp clothing is ideal for everyday wear, active lifestyles, and even hot climates because of its cooling properties.
Inside the stem lies the woody core, called hurds or shives. This inner material serves as an excellent base for eco-friendly building products. When mixed with lime and water, it forms hempcrete—a lightweight, insulating composite that is breathable, fire-resistant, and naturally mold-resistant. Hempcrete walls regulate humidity and temperature effectively, creating healthier indoor environments while reducing energy needs for heating and cooling.
Hemp seeds are nutrient powerhouses. They offer a complete plant-based protein source, containing all essential amino acids in good proportions. The seeds are also rich in healthy fats, particularly omega-3 and omega-6 in an optimal balance that supports cardiovascular health and reduces inflammation. People enjoy hemp seeds whole, shelled, or ground into powder. They add a mild, nutty flavor to cereals, yogurt, salads, and baked goods. Cold-pressed hemp seed oil is widely used in cooking, dressings, and supplements because it retains its beneficial properties without high-heat processing.
Beyond food and fiber, hemp finds applications in personal care and manufacturing. Hemp oil moisturizes skin effectively and soothes irritation when used in lotions, balms, and soaps. In industry, hemp fibers reinforce natural composites for automotive parts, reducing weight and improving fuel efficiency. These materials are renewable and often more biodegradable than traditional plastics.
Hemp paper production highlights another major advantage. One acre of hemp can yield significantly more pulp than an acre of trees, and the crop is ready to harvest in months rather than decades. Hemp paper is durable, holds ink well, and can be recycled repeatedly without degrading as quickly as wood pulp paper.
Sustainable agriculture benefits greatly from hemp. The plant sequesters carbon efficiently during its rapid growth, helping combat climate change. It requires fewer inputs than many cash crops and rotates easily with others to maintain soil fertility and disrupt pest cycles. Farmers in diverse regions find hemp adaptable to various climates and soil conditions.
